Kevin Durant donates $1 million to tornado victims

kevin durant

Oklahoma Thunder star Kevin Durant is donating $1 million to the Red Cross tornado and disaster relief fund to aid the victims of massive storms that devastated the greater Oklahoma City region Monday.

The All-Star forward has made large donations in the aftermath of tragedies and natural disasters in the past. In 2010, he donated $100,000 to the Athlete Relief Fund for Haiti, which paired Durant, LeBron James, Dwyane Wade and others to offer direct contributions to those directly impacted by earthquakes in Haiti.

Also, the NBA and its players’ association announced Tuesday that they will donate $1 million to support the relief efforts.

Los Angeles Dodgers outfielder Matt Kemp pledged $1,000 per home run hit between Monday and the Major League Baseball All-Star break in July to the Oklahoma storm victims.

Lil’ Wayne Gets Dissed By Oklahoma City Thunder…AGAIN!

It looks like authorities over at Oklahoma City Arena are not feeling Lil’ Wayne.

Judging by the following tweet, he wasn’t allowed into the venue once again, this time to watch the OKC Thunder take on the Miami Heat.

As we previously reported, Weezy planned to go see OKC Thunder take on the San Antonio Spurs in the Western Conference finals last week, but was denied entry into the Oklahoma City arena. Apparently officials wouldn’t let the rapper sit courtside, nor would they allow him to enter from anywhere other than the main entrance.
